SWEET PEPPERS Capsicum annum
Native to the Americas, peppers come in thousands of varieties, many unusual flavors, and all shapes and sizes. Heirloom peppers are usually more flavorful than the modern type peppers, and most give huge yields. They are one of the easiest crops to grow, and are not much bothered by pests. Bull Nose
The original, Bull Nose pepper was popular in early America and was grown by Thomas Jefferson. They are still grown at Monticello today. This is one of the first, medium-large, "bell" type peppers. Although, this strain may be larger than the strain grown by Mr. Jefferson. It most likely dates back to the Bull Nose of the mid to late 1800's. Delicious, good-sized fruit are great in salads or for cooking.

Charleston Belle     New!
The first nematode-resistant bell pepper. Large, beautiful fruit are smooth and of good quality. A great pepper for the South or areas where nematodes are a problem. Attractive, compact plants produce fairly early. Developed by the USDA in Charleston, South Carolina.

Sweet Yellow Stuffing Peppers - Sweet seeds Sweet Yellow Stuffing     New!
This amazing little pepper comes to us from Amish grower Ester Smucker of Indiana. The seed was passed down to her from her Grandmother, whom she fondly remembers growing these peppers in the 1950s in Lancaster, Pennsylvania. The very productive plants produce the cutest little mini bell-shaped peppers, only 1"-2" across! Ester uses these to make wonderful stuff ed and pickled peppers!
